Once Upon a Time in Yunkui is a Trust Commission for Pan Yinhu inside Suibian Temple.
Steps
- Check what Pan Yinhu is up to late at night
Gameplay Notes
- Pan Yinhu will only be available at midnight.
- Completing this commission awards the Agent Trust achievement Let Your Senior Cook for You.

Notes
- ↑ Untranslatable joke: Pan Yinhu talks about bears and cats because the literal translation of 熊猫 xióngmāo, the Chinese term for panda, is "bear-cat". Pan Yinhu is thus implying that, unlike its name components, "bear" and "cat", the "bear-cat" is a rare type of Thiren.
